Rose Colors and Meanings
Roses aren't just pretty; they have meanings, you know! Red roses scream romance, while white roses symbolize purity and innocence. Pink roses represent grace and sweetness, and yellow roses shout friendship and joy. Knowing the meanings can add a special touch to your bouquet! Beyond color, the *type* of rose matters too! Garden roses, with their overflowing petals, create a lush, romantic look, perfect for a whimsical wedding. David Austin roses, known for their old-fashioned charm, add a touch of vintage elegance. And let's not forget the classic, perfectly formed standard roses – they're always a timeless choice. Bouquet Shape | Description | Best For |
---|---|---|
Round | Classic and symmetrical | Traditional weddings |
Cascading | Long and flowing | Romantic, bohemian weddings |
Posy | Small and tightly bound | Modern, minimalist weddings |
Next, consider the size. A petite bouquet is perfect for a simple dress, while a larger bouquet can balance out a more elaborate gown. Remember, you want your bouquet to complement your overall look, not overpower it. Don't forget about the other flowers! Adding some greenery, like eucalyptus or ruscus, can add texture and visual interest. Other flowers, such as delphiniums or anemones, can create a beautiful color contrast and add even more personality. For some awesome ideas, check out our !

Budgeting for Your Rose Bouquet
Let's talk money – a super important part of wedding planning! The cost of hand-tied wedding bouquets with roses can vary wildly, depending on the type of roses, the number of stems, and any extra flowers or greenery. A simple bouquet with a dozen standard roses might cost around $50-$100, but a more elaborate arrangement with a mix of roses, peonies, and lush greenery could easily reach $200 or more. Think of it like pizza – you can get a basic cheese pizza for a reasonable price, or you can go all out with gourmet toppings and fancy crust and the price will shoot up! It's all about what you want and what you're willing to spend. To get a better idea of costs in your area, check out our for pricing inspiration.
Rose Type | Quantity | Approximate Cost |
---|---|---|
Standard Roses | 12 | $50 - $100 |
Garden Roses | 10 | $100 - $150 |
David Austin Roses | 8 | $150 - $200+ |
Delivery and Other Important Details
Once you've chosen your perfect bouquet, you'll need to think about delivery. Many florists offer delivery services, but the cost and delivery time will depend on your location and the florist's policies. Some florists might offer same-day delivery for an extra fee, while others may have a longer lead time. It's always a good idea to book your florist well in advance, especially if you're having a wedding during peak season. This ensures you get your dream bouquet on time.
